Bonita Springs,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Bonita Springs?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bonita Springs 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,877 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
Bonita Springs 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,569 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
Bonita Springs 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$9,386 | $2,300 | $10,000+ |
Bonita Springs 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$21,833 | $5,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bonita Springs
What type of rentals are currently available in Bonita Springs?
There are currently 200 Apartments for Rent in Bonita Springs,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,299 to $9,880. There are also 960 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Bonita Springs ranging from $1,395 to $100,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Bonita Springs?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Bonita Springs ranges from $1,395 to $100,000 with an average monthly rent of $8,047.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Bonita Springs?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Bonita Springs range from $1,975 to $9,880,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,900 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,300 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,513.
